Blomstedt Conducts Dvořák 8

Mar 9 - Mar 12, 2023
Herbert Blomstedt leads the Chicago Symphony Orchestra in Orchestra Hall

Overview

Eminent Swedish American conductor Herbert Blomstedt leads two Dvořák landmarks — the restless, bucolic Eighth Symphony and the impassioned Cello Concerto — each imbued with the composer’s hallmark warmth and Bohemian charm. Joining the CSO is the young Romanian Andrei Ioniţă, “one of the most exciting cellists to have emerged for a decade” (The Times of London).

Andrei Ioniță says of Dvořák's Cello Concerto: "No matter what cellist you would ask, even though they might have some emotional favorite, everybody would tell you that this particular work is the epitome of cello playing,”

Herbert Blomstedt has no plans to retire. “I just love the music so much that I just can’t give up,” said the conductor, now 94. “There are always things that I want to learn. I’m never satisfied."
